Webb29 jan. 2024 · The criterion for the above‐normal range of hemoglobin concentration is generally 16.0 g/dL; however, the number of women with hemoglobin ≥16.0 g/dL was too low in the general population. For this reason, we used a hemoglobin concentration of 14.0 g/dL in women. When you enter "drop" the next screen gives option of "Hematocrit (precipitous) and "Hemoglobin". If you select "Hemoglobin" It gives you 790.01. This code will move the DRG because it is a "cc". When you reference the code book it shows. 790.01 Precipitous drop in hematocrit.
